Output 523da908cb0f019e1674a13585e017cc315497129c41ec02039b23e093c89f03:97

value
287176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c3c9b67a6ce79f926e40f8b9b362d262f1224b OP_EQUAL
address
3ChZZ9Y9dWoHSMzj3AmzNovcZ7YjmtD1hS
transaction
523da908cb0f019e1674a13585e017cc315497129c41ec02039b23e093c89f03
spent
true